Brazil: Prisons in state of emergency

RIO DE JANEIRO, June 7 (UPI) -- Rio officials have declared a state of emergency in the state penitentiary system, local news sources reported Monday.

Agencia Estado news agency reported Rio state Gov. Rosinha Matheus signed an ordinance allotting emergency funds to increase safety and stability in the state's prisons.

Violence has always been a problem in Rio's gang-dominated, overcrowded prisons, though in recent weeks the killings and escapes have reached a new level of carnage.

On Saturday, 20 inmates escaped from a Petropolis prison -- 25 miles north of Rio de Janeiro -- during a rebellion. Only 10 prisoners have been recaptured.

Last week, 30 inmates and a guard were killed during a days-long prison fight between rival gangs at another Rio prison.
